Summary

Best friends need to be together. Don't they?

Poor Megan! Not only is she stuck with totally uncool parents and a little sister who is too cute for words but also her very best friend, Alice, has moved away.

Now Megan has to go to school and face the dreaded Melissa all on her own.

The two friends hatch a risky plot to get back together. But can their secret plan work?

©2005 Judi Curtin (P)2015 Bolinda Publishing Pty Ltd
